The Lake Erie Monsters are an ice hockey team in the American Hockey League. They began play in the 2007-08 AHL season at the Quicken Loans Arena in Cleveland, Ohio, USA. The team is the minor league affiliate of the Colorado Avalanche of the NHL.

History

The Lake Erie Monsters began with the revival of the dormant Utah Grizzlies franchise. The team was relocated to Cleveland, playing as the Lake Erie Monsters in the North Division.[1] The team name, referring to Bessie, a creature of local folklore, was announced at a press conference by Dan Gilbert, owner of the Monsters, Cleveland Cavaliers NBA basketball team, and Quicken Loans.[2] The Monsters opened their inaugural 2007-08 campaign at home against the Grand Rapids Griffins on October 6, 2007.[3] This market was previously served by:
